How do I know if my ducts need cleaning?
Common signs include visible dust buildup around vents, increased allergy symptoms indoors, musty or stale odors when the system runs, and reduced airflow in certain rooms. If your system hasn't been serviced in several years, it's worth having an inspection.

How often should air ducts be cleaned?
The National Air Duct Cleaners Association (NADCA) recommends having your ducts cleaned every three to five years, or sooner if you have pets, recent renovations, or household members with allergies or asthma.
